Cheyenne Diner, 33 Street and 9th Avenue, New York City




I used to eat eggs and hash browns for breakfast at this diner, when I first came to New York City in the early eighties. For the first time in more than 25 years, I went back yesterday for a late breakfast. The food was the same, but the staff was different. The place is now run by hardworking and superfriendly Mexicans. They seem to like my good friend, Mads Mikkelsen.
